探索有向无环图(DAG):定义、应用与前景(DAG货币资讯)

有向无环图(DAG)是图论中的一个重要概念,它在许多领域都有着广泛的应用。本文将深入探讨DAG的定义、特性、以及在不同领域的应用,最后对其未来的发展趋势进行分析。

DAG的定义与特性

有向无环图,如其名所示,是一个没有闭合环路的有向图。在这种图中,每条边都有一个方向,从一个顶点指向另一个顶点。这种结构使得DAG在数据表示和处理方面极为有效,尤其是在需要表示有序关系的场合。

DAG在数据处理中的应用

DAG在数据处理领域中扮演着关键角色。例如,在编译原理中,DAG用于表示和优化表达式;在工作流管理系统中,DAG用于描述任务间的依赖关系。这些应用凸显了DAG在高效处理复杂数据结构中的重要性。

DAG在网络调度中的作用

在网络调度和通信网络中,DAG用于优化数据包的路由和调度。通过DAG,可以有效地规划网络流量,避免数据冲突和拥堵,从而提高网络效率和稳定性。

DAG与加密货币

在加密货币领域,DAG提供了一种与传统区块链不同的数据结构。比如IOTA使用DAG来提高交易处理的速度和效率,这表明DAG在未来加密货币技术中可能扮演更加重要的角色。

DAG的未来展望

随着技术的不断发展,DAG的应用领域将会进一步扩大。在人工智能、大数据分析、分布式系统等方面,DAG都有着巨大的应用潜力。

结论

有向无环图(DAG)作为一种强大的图论工具,在多个领域都展现出了其独特的价值和潜力。随着技术的发展,我们可以预见,DAG将在未来的科技领域中扮演更加重要的角色。

发表评论